The Opportunity
We are currently seeking a Senior Finance Manager to join our team at Southern Cross Medical Care Society. This is an exciting opportunity for someone with proven financial management experience and a passion for driving strategic initiatives that support the growth of our organization.
- Key responsibilities include managing budgets, overseeing financial reporting, and 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ements.
- You will also be responsible for developing financial strategies to support business objectives and providing insights to senior leadership on financial performance.
What You'll Do
Your primary duties will involve:
- Developing and managing the annual budget and ensuring accurate financial reporting.
- Providing financial analysis and recommendations for cost control measures.
- Overseeing cash flow management, working capital, and liquidity.
- Staying updated with regulatory changes and implementing necessary adjustments to our processes.
Who We're Looking For
We are looking for a Senior Finance Manager who:
- Possesses a strong background in finance and accounting, preferably with a relevant degree or certification such as CPA or ACCA.
- Has at least 7 years of experience in financial management within the healthcare sector.
- Is proficient in using financial software and tools for budgeting, forecasting, and analysis.
- Demonstrates excellent communication skills and can effectively present financial data to non-financial stakeholders.

New Zealand (nationwide) is an island country in the southwestern Pacific Ocean. It consists of two main landmasses—the North Island and the South Island —and over 600 smaller islands. It is the sixth-largest island country by area and lies east of Australia across the Tasman Sea and south of the islands of New Caledonia, Fiji, and Tonga. The country's varied topography and sharp mountain peaks, including the Southern Alps, owe much to tectonic uplift and volcanic eruptions. New Zealand (nationwide)'s capital city is Wellington, and its most populous city is Auckland.
